Exploring the psychology of crowds, this work delves into various historical phenomena where mass delusions took hold, revealing how collective behavior can lead to irrational decisions. Mackay examines notable events such as the South Sea Bubble and the Tulip Mania, illustrating the impact of speculation and frenzy on society. Through engaging anecdotes and analysis, the book highlights the recurring patterns of human folly, making it a timeless commentary on the nature of belief and the susceptibility of people to extraordinary delusions.
